#234b2f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#234b2f is composed of 13.7% red, 29.4% green and 18.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 37.3% yellow and 70.6% black. It has a hue angle of 138 degrees, a saturation of 36.4% and a lightness of 21.6%. #234b2f color hex could be obtained by blending #46965e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

Shades and Tints of #234b2f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040805 is the darkest color, while #fafdf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#234b2f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#343a36 is the less saturated color, while #016d21 is the most saturated one.
